76 static int
77 hp300_setboot(ib_params *params)
78 {
79 	int		retval;
80 	uint8_t		*bootstrap;
81 	ssize_t		rv;
82 	struct partition *boot;
83 	struct hp300_lifdir *lifdir;
84 	int		offset;
85 	int		i;
86 	unsigned int	secsize = HP300_SECTSIZE;
87 	uint64_t	boot_size, boot_offset;
88 	char		label_buf[DEV_BSIZE];
89 	struct disklabel *label = (void *)label_buf;
90 
91 	assert(params != NULL);
92 	assert(params->fsfd != -1);
93 	assert(params->filesystem != NULL);
94 	assert(params->s1fd != -1);
95 	assert(params->stage1 != NULL);
96 
97 	retval = 0;
98 	bootstrap = MAP_FAILED;
99 
100 	if (params->flags & IB_APPEND) {
101 		if (!S_ISREG(params->fsstat.st_mode)) {
102 			warnx(
103 		    "`%s' must be a regular file to append a bootstrap",
104 			    params->filesystem);
105 			goto done;
106 		}
107 		boot_offset = roundup(params->fsstat.st_size, HP300_SECTSIZE);
108 	} else {
109 		/*
110 		 * The bootstrap can be well over 8k, and must go into a BOOT
111 		 * partition. Read NetBSD label to locate BOOT partition.
112 		 */
113 		if (pread(params->fsfd, label, DEV_BSIZE, 2 * DEV_BSIZE)
114 								!= DEV_BSIZE) {
115 			warn("reading disklabel");
116 			goto done;
117 		}
118 		/* And a quick validation - must be a big-endian label */
119 		secsize = be32toh(label->d_secsize);
120 		if (label->d_magic != be32toh(DISKMAGIC) ||
121 		    label->d_magic2 != be32toh(DISKMAGIC) ||
122 		    secsize == 0 || secsize & (secsize - 1) ||
123 		    be32toh(label->d_npartitions) > MAXMAXPARTITIONS) {
124 			warnx("Invalid disklabel in %s", params->filesystem);
125 			goto done;
126 		}
127 
128 		i = be32toh(label->d_npartitions);
129 		for (boot = label->d_partitions; ; boot++) {
130 			if (--i < 0) {
131 				warnx("No BOOT partition");
132 				goto done;
133 			}
134 			if (boot->p_fstype == FS_BOOT)
135 				break;
136 		}
137 		boot_size = be32toh(boot->p_size) * (uint64_t)secsize;
138 		boot_offset = be32toh(boot->p_offset) * (uint64_t)secsize;
139 
140 		/*
141 		 * We put the entire LIF file into the BOOT partition even when
142 		 * it doesn't start at the beginning of the disk.
143 		 *
144 		 * Maybe we ought to be able to take a binary file and add
145 		 * it to the LIF filesystem.
146 		 */
147 		if (boot_size < params->s1stat.st_size) {
148 			warn("BOOT partition too small (%llu < %llu)",
149 				(unsigned long long)boot_size,
150 				(unsigned long long)params->s1stat.st_size);
151 			goto done;
152 		}
153 	}
154 
155 	bootstrap = mmap(NULL, params->s1stat.st_size, PROT_READ | PROT_WRITE,
156 			    MAP_PRIVATE, params->s1fd, 0);
157 	if (bootstrap == MAP_FAILED) {
158 		warn("mmaping `%s'", params->stage1);
159 		goto done;
160 	}
161 
162 	/* Relocate files, sanity check LIF directory on the way */
163 	lifdir = (void *)(bootstrap + HP300_SECTSIZE * 2);
164 	for (i = 0; i < 8; lifdir++, i++) {
165 		int addr = be32toh(lifdir->dir_addr);
166 		int limit = (params->s1stat.st_size - 1) / HP300_SECTSIZE + 1;
167 		if (addr + be32toh(lifdir->dir_length) > limit) {
168 			warnx("LIF entry %d larger (%d %d) than LIF file",
169 				i,  addr + be32toh(lifdir->dir_length), limit);
170 			goto done;
171 		}
172 		if (addr != 0 && boot_offset != 0)
173 			lifdir->dir_addr = htobe32(addr + boot_offset
174 							    / HP300_SECTSIZE);
175 	}
176 
177 	if (params->flags & IB_NOWRITE) {
178 		retval = 1;
179 		goto done;
180 	}
181 
182 	/* Write LIF volume header and directory to sectors 0 and 1 */
183 	rv = pwrite(params->fsfd, bootstrap, 1024, 0);
184 	if (rv != 1024) {
185 		if (rv == -1)
186 			warn("Writing `%s'", params->filesystem);
187 		else
188 			warnx("Writing `%s': short write", params->filesystem);
189 		goto done;
190 	}
191 
192 	/* Write files to BOOT partition */
193 	offset = boot_offset <= HP300_SECTSIZE * 16 ? HP300_SECTSIZE * 16 : 0;
194 	i = roundup(params->s1stat.st_size, secsize) - offset;
195 	rv = pwrite(params->fsfd, bootstrap + offset, i, boot_offset + offset);
196 	if (rv != i) {
197 		if (rv == -1)
198 			warn("Writing boot filesystem of `%s'",
199 				params->filesystem);
200 		else
201 			warnx("Writing boot filesystem of `%s': short write",
202 				params->filesystem);
203 		goto done;
204 	}
205 
206 	retval = 1;
207 
208  done:
209 	if (bootstrap != MAP_FAILED)
210 		munmap(bootstrap, params->s1stat.st_size);
211 	return retval;
212 }
